数控车床编程与UG的不同之处
在数控加工领域,数控车床编程和UG作为两种常用的编程方式,各有其特点和优势。从专业角度来看,两者在操作方式、功能应用和适用范围等方面存在显著差异。
在操作方式上,数控车床编程采用G代码进行编程,而UG则采用参数化编程。G代码编程需要程序员对机床的运动轨迹、刀具路径等有深入了解,编程过程较为繁琐。而UG参数化编程则通过建立模型、设置参数来实现编程,操作简便,易于掌握。
在功能应用方面,数控车床编程主要应用于简单的车削加工,如外圆、内孔、螺纹等。其编程功能相对单一,难以满足复杂加工需求。而UG作为一款三维建模与加工软件,具有丰富的功能,如曲面建模、装配、CAM等,适用于各类复杂零件的加工。
再次,从适用范围来看,数控车床编程主要应用于传统的单机加工,而UG则可应用于多轴联动加工、五轴加工等。在多轴联动加工中,UG可充分发挥其优势,实现复杂零件的高精度加工。
具体来说,以下从以下几个方面对比数控车床编程与UG的不同:
1. 编程语言:数控车床编程采用G代码,编程语言较为简单,但难以实现复杂功能。UG则采用参数化编程,编程语言丰富,易于实现复杂功能。
2. 操作界面:数控车床编程界面相对简单,主要展示G代码信息。而UG界面功能丰富,包括建模、装配、CAM等模块,便于用户进行各类操作。
3. 加工精度:数控车床编程在加工精度方面相对较低,适用于简单零件的加工。UG则具有较高加工精度,可满足复杂零件的加工需求。
4. 适用范围:数控车床编程主要应用于单机加工,而UG可应用于多轴联动加工、五轴加工等,适用范围更广。
5. 学习难度:数控车床编程学习难度较低,但难以掌握复杂编程技巧。UG学习难度较高,但可满足各类加工需求。
数控车床编程与UG在操作方式、功能应用和适用范围等方面存在显著差异。在实际应用中,应根据加工需求选择合适的编程方式。对于简单零件的加工,数控车床编程较为适用;而对于复杂零件的加工,UG则具有明显优势。随着技术的发展,UG等三维建模与加工软件将逐渐取代传统的数控车床编程,成为未来加工领域的主流。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。